Cigarette butt did it

The fire that destroyed the headquarters of the Commission on Elections (Comelec) in Intramuros, Manila was not caused by electrical overload, faulty electrical wiring or by sabotage, according to the Comelec Chairman Benjamin Abalos Sr.

Since the fire could not have materialized out of thin air, somebody has got to take the rap.

Is Abalos blaming the Marine guards who were supposed to be guarding the building but were nowhere when the fire started? No.

Is he blaming the firefighters for their failure to put out the fire even if the fire station was just a spitting distance from the Comelec office? Nope.

Is he blaming his staff for being careless? No, no, no.

Is he blaming himself for lack of foresight? Definitely not!

Who is he blaming then?

The cigarette butt! Yes, Abalos said a lighted cigarette butt accidentally thrown into a pile of old papers caused the fire.

Now that’s a new reason for waging a campaign against cigarette smoking. It can destroy one’s lungs and even a building!
